Medicare Alternatives

Navigating the world of can be daunting. While Medicare provides a fundamental safety net, many seniors find they need supplemental coverage to fully meet their health needs. Thankfully, there are numerous Medicare alternatives available that offer tailored plans to fit individual requirements and budgets. These options can help bridge the gaps in traditional Medicare coverage, providing peace of mind for seniors as they age .

  • Dive into some popular Medicare alternatives:
  • MA Plans: These plans offer an complete solution, bundling your Part A and outpatient coverage with additional benefits
  • Medicare Supplement Insurance : These plans cover copayments and deductibles associated with traditional Medicare.

Affordable Health Coverage: Solutions for Seniors

Finding affordable health coverage can be a major challenge for seniors. As we grow older, our medical requirements often become more complex. Thankfully, there are numerous alternatives available to assist seniors secure the insurance they deserve.

One option is Medicare, a federal scheme that offers health insurance to seniors aged 65 and senior. Additionally, there are Medicare Advantage which offer extra advantages such as dental, vision, and hearing coverage. Private health plans can also be a viable option, particularly for those requiring greater insurance.
